## Break-Glass Access — GridWeaver Crossword Engine

If your plugin loses its signing session and the GridWeaver sandbox locks you out mid-puzzle-build, don't panic. File a break-glass request in the plugin portal, then confirm with the on-call reviewer. Once approved, unlock the emergency vault using the passphrase below.

unlock words, hahip-yagef: zorok-novmir-zorix-silax

Handover: Orchardline zero-downtime migrations

For whoever picks this up — the customers table migration is mid-flight using the expand/contract pattern. New columns are live and dual-written; the backfill job is about 70% done and should finish overnight. Do not run the contract step until the verification script reports zero drift. Support may see brief replica lag alerts; these are expected during backfill batches. The migration runner is currently operating with the configuration below.

deployment values, bahof-badug:
[rusix]
team = zorok
access_code = ac_641cbe
owner = ulair.tamius
host = rusix.torvasoft.local
port = 5672
peer = ulaix.sivrelworks.internal
salt = 1df570ed
pin = 6327

Ticket: Config drift behind the flaky PayLoop integration tests

Heads up for release: the PayLoop staging env has drifted from what CI expects — retry counts and ledger timeouts got bumped by hand during last week's firefight, which explains the flaky integration runs. We should re-sync before tagging. Here's what staging is actually running right now.

deployment values, hahip-kajep:
HOLAX_PIN=4003
HOLAX_METRICS_HOST=metrics.holax.zemvarworks.internal
HOLAX_LOG_LEVEL=warn
HOLAX_TENANT=fraael